Hazardous Waste Identification

Identifying hazardous waste is crucial in managing ceramic coating waste effectively. Ceramic coatings often contain chemicals that can be harmful to both the environment and human health. Ingredients such as solvents and heavy metals present in these coatings may pose significant risks if not handled properly. Familiarity with the safety data sheets (SDS) provided by manufacturers is essential to recognise the nature of the substances involved. These sheets outline the hazards associated with the materials and recommend appropriate safety measures.

In addition to reviewing safety data sheets, understanding local regulations regarding hazardous waste can help in identifying what constitutes hazardous material. Specific components like titanium dioxide or lead compounds commonly found in ceramic coatings may require special handling or disposal procedures. Proper identification ensures that any waste generated is classified correctly, which in turn facilitates compliance with environmental standards and reduces the risk of potential harm during disposal. Familiarising oneself with these guidelines serves as the first step in responsible waste management practices.

Proper Storage Techniques for Waste

Effective storage of ceramic coating waste is critical to ensure safety and compliance with environmental regulations. Utilising designated, clearly labelled containers can help prevent accidental exposure and contamination. These containers should be made from materials resistant to the chemicals present in the waste. It is essential to keep them sealed tightly when not in use. Placement in a cool, well-ventilated area away from direct sunlight minimises the risk of heat-induced reactions.

Periodic inspection of storage facilities is vital to identify any signs of leaks or damage. Adopting appropriate safety signage around waste storage areas can alert staff to potential hazards associated with the materials. Proper training for personnel who handle these wastes is equally important. Competence in recognising the characteristics of different waste types enhances safety protocols and minimises risks during both storage and eventual disposal.

How can I identify if my ceramic coating waste is hazardous?

You can identify hazardous waste by checking for specific characteristics such as ignitability, corrosivity, reactivity, and toxicity. Consulting the Material Safety Data Sheet (MSDS) for the products used can also provide crucial information.
